BRIGHT LIGHTS. BRIGHT FUTURES. Honoring Angela Ryan as our 2025 Sweetheart

This year, we are thrilled to celebrate the 40th anniversary of our beloved Sweetheart Gala & Auction by honoring Angela Ryan as our 2025 Sweetheart. Angela personifies the dedication, community spirit, and resilience we strive to foster at Boys & Girls Clubs of Sonoma Valley (BGCSV) and throughout the broader Sonoma Valley, embodying the phrase, ‘Once a Club Kid, Always a Club Kid.’

A Tradition of Celebrating Community Leaders

The Sweetheart Gala & Auction is a long-standing tradition — a night to honor those who have profoundly impacted our organization and the lives of youth and families in Sonoma Valley. In recent years, we’ve celebrated Lyn & Dub Hay, whose work with nonprofits across the Valley has left an indelible mark, and Chuck and Cathy Williamson, whose commitment to both Teen Services and BGCSV has exemplified the spirit of community. This year, the 40th Annual Sweetheart Gala & Auction, we are proud to continue this legacy by recognizing Angela Ryan, whose support and passion for the youth of Sonoma Valley is nothing short of inspiring.

Angela’s Impact

Angela is not only a dedicated Club parent and past Club member, but she’s also a fierce advocate for youth and teens across Sonoma Valley. Her visionary spirit has been instrumental in creating some of our most impactful programs, including the Teen Internship Program and the Empowerment Academy at Sonoma Valley High School. Angela’s deep involvement behind the scenes has expanded opportunities for local youth, making a lasting impact on their lives and futures.

“When Angela says, ‘I have an idea,’ you know something amazing is about to unfold,” said Cary Snowden, CEO of BGCSV. “She has an undeniable passion for tackling challenges.”

As a former Executive Director of the Sonoma Valley Education Foundation, Angela championed initiatives that enriched our programs, from mental health services to literacy development to enhancing our overall capacity. Her contributions have helped us grow our capacity and reach more young people with the resources they need to succeed.
